This paper aims to develop a conceptual model based on the Technology–Organization–Environment (TOE) framework for measuring the intention to adopt virtual reality (VR) and augmented reality (AR) technologies within Jordan’s industrial sector supply chain management (SCM). The study identifies 14 significant factors categorized into technological, organizational, and environmental dimensions that influence adoption decisions. These factors underscore the multifaceted nature of technology adoption and highlight the complex interplay of internal and external elements shaping organizational readiness in Jordan. By systematically addressing these factors, organizations can enhance their understanding of the benefits and challenges associated with AR and VR adoption, enabling informed decision-making and successful technology integration. Recommendations include promoting awareness through demonstrations of relative advantage and compatibility, enhancing organizational readiness through infrastructure investment and training, securing top management support, leveraging government incentives, fostering innovation culture, addressing socioeconomic barriers, and implementing continuous monitoring and evaluation mechanisms. Future research should expand the TOE framework, explore sector-specific adoption challenges, and investigate the integration of emerging technologies to advance SCM practices in Jordan’s industrial sector.
